Vocabulary Word

Definition
'Environment effects' are changes we notice because of where we are or what's happening around us. Like your phone signal getting weaker in a tunnel, the tunnel is the environment affecting your phone signal.
Examples in Different Contexts
In policy making, discussing 'environment effects' involves examining how laws affect the environment. A policy maker might argue, 'We need to assess the environment effects of this new agricultural policy carefully.'
